Office深度集成DeepSeek:打造智能办公新范式
一、技术融合背景与核心价值
在数字化转型浪潮中,企业办公场景对智能化需求呈现指数级增长。微软Office作为全球使用最广泛的办公套件,其功能扩展性为AI技术落地提供了天然土壤。DeepSeek作为具备自然语言处理、文档智能解析与自动化决策能力的AI框架,与Office的深度集成可实现三大核心价值:
- 效率跃迁:通过AI自动完成重复性文档处理任务,如合同条款比对、数据透视表生成等,将人工操作耗时降低70%以上
- 决策赋能:在Excel中嵌入智能预测模型,可基于历史数据自动生成业务趋势分析报告
- 体验升级:Word文档中的智能校对功能可识别专业领域术语错误,准确率较传统语法检查提升3倍
微软官方发布的Office插件开发规范(MSDN-28931)明确指出,通过COM组件、Office JS API及VBA宏三种技术路径均可实现外部系统集成。其中Office JS API作为现代Web技术栈的标准接口,支持跨平台(Windows/macOS/Web)部署,成为DeepSeek集成的首选方案。
二、技术实现路径详解
(一)架构设计要点
-
分层架构:
graph TDA[Office客户端] --> B(Office JS API)B --> C{DeepSeek服务层}C --> D[NLP处理引擎]C --> E[文档解析模块]C --> F[自动化工作流]
采用微服务架构将AI计算与Office前端解耦,通过RESTful API实现安全通信
-
数据流优化:
- 文档内容提取:使用Office JS的Document.getSelectedDataAsync()方法获取选中区域文本
- 上下文传递:通过JSON Schema定义请求/响应结构,确保10KB以内的小数据包传输
- 结果渲染:采用增量更新机制,避免全文档重绘导致的性能卡顿
(二)关键开发步骤
-
环境准备:
- 安装Node.js 16+与Office JS API类型定义
- 配置Azure AD应用注册,获取Client ID与Tenant ID
- 在Word/Excel中启用”开发工具”选项卡(文件>选项>自定义功能区)
-
核心代码实现:
// Excel智能数据清洗示例async function cleanData() {await Excel.run(async (context) => {const sheet = context.workbook.worksheets.getActiveWorksheet();const range = sheet.getRange("A1:D100");// 调用DeepSeek API进行异常值检测const response = await fetch("https://api.deepseek.com/v1/data/clean", {method: "POST",body: JSON.stringify({data: await range.load("values").then(r => r.values)})});const result = await response.json();range.values = result.cleanedData;await context.sync();});}
-
安全加固措施:
- 实现OAuth 2.0授权流程,确保文档内容不离开企业安全边界
- 采用TLS 1.3加密通信,禁用不安全的加密套件
- 实施CSP(内容安全策略)防止XSS攻击
三、典型应用场景解析
(一)智能文档处理
-
合同风险识别:
- 嵌入DeepSeek的法律条款解析模型,自动标记权利义务不对等条款
- 示例:识别”甲方有权单方面变更合同”等霸王条款,准确率达92%
-
多语言校对:
- 结合NLP翻译记忆库,实现中英双语文档的术语一致性检查
- 某跨国企业应用后,技术文档的翻译错误率从15%降至3%
(二)数据智能分析
-
动态预测看板:
- 在Excel中创建可交互的AI预测模型,支持销售目标动态调整
- 输入参数:历史销售额、市场活动投入、季节因子
- 输出结果:95%置信区间的预测区间图
-
异常检测报警:
- 实时监控财务数据中的异常波动,如连续3个月成本增长率超过20%
- 自动生成包含根因分析的预警报告
(三)自动化工作流
-
邮件智能分类:
- 集成DeepSeek的文本分类模型,自动将收件箱邮件归类至项目文件夹
- 某咨询公司应用后,邮件处理效率提升40%
-
会议纪要生成:
- 通过Word插件实时转写会议语音,自动提取行动项与决策点
- 支持多说话人识别与时间轴标注功能
四、部署与运维指南
(一)部署方案选择
| 方案类型 | 适用场景 | 优势 | 限制 |
|---|---|---|---|
| 本地部署 | 金融、政府等高安全要求机构 | 数据不出域,完全可控 | 需配备GPU服务器集群 |
| 混合云部署 | 中型企业标准化办公场景 | 平衡安全性与成本 | 需维护跨网络通信通道 |
| SaaS化部署 | 初创企业快速验证阶段 | 开箱即用,零基础设施投入 | 依赖第三方服务可用性 |
(二)性能优化策略
-
缓存机制:
- 实现文档特征指纹计算,对相同内容请求复用AI计算结果
- 某制造企业应用后,API调用量减少65%
-
异步处理:
- 对耗时超过3秒的操作启用Web Worker
- 示例代码:
const worker = new Worker('deepseek-processor.js');worker.postMessage({task: 'analyze', data: documentText});worker.onmessage = (e) => {updateUI(e.data.result);};
-
负载均衡:
- 基于Kubernetes的自动扩缩容策略,应对早9点办公高峰
五、未来演进方向
-
多模态交互:
- 集成语音指令控制,实现”说文档”生成功能
- 示例:用户语音描述”创建包含Q3销售数据的柱状图”,AI自动完成操作
-
增强分析:
- 在PowerPoint中嵌入因果推理引擎,自动生成数据背后的业务洞察
- 某零售企业应用后,管理层决策效率提升50%
-
区块链存证:
- 对AI生成的文档修改记录进行哈希上链,确保操作可追溯
结语
Office与DeepSeek的深度集成标志着办公自动化进入智能时代。通过遵循本文阐述的技术路径与开发实践,企业可在6-8周内完成核心功能落地,实现人均效能提升35%以上的显著收益。建议开发者从文档校对、数据清洗等高频痛点切入,采用MVP(最小可行产品)模式快速验证价值,再逐步扩展至复杂业务场景。随着AI技术的持续演进,这种集成模式将成为企业数字化转型的基础设施级能力。